F.M.J. Debruyne is a scholar working on Surgery,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Urology. According to data from OpenAlex, F.M.J. Debruyne has authored 108 papers receiving a total of 3.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 50 papers in Surgery, 34 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 31 papers in Urology. Recurrent topics in F.M.J. Debruyne's work include Bladder and Urothelial Cancer Treatments (29 papers), Urinary Bladder and Prostate Research (23 papers) and Urinary and Genital Oncology Studies (18 papers). F.M.J. Debruyne is often cited by papers focused on Bladder and Urothelial Cancer Treatments (29 papers), Urinary Bladder and Prostate Research (23 papers) and Urinary and Genital Oncology Studies (18 papers). F.M.J. Debruyne collaborates with scholars based in Netherlands, Belgium and United Kingdom. F.M.J. Debruyne's co-authors include J. Alfred Witjes, Jean de la Rosette, Wim P.J. Witjes, Jack A. Schalken, H. Ewout Schaafsma, Rainy Umbas, Richard Sylvester, Herbert F.M. Karthaus, P P Bringuier and Pierre Delaere and has published in prestigious journals such as The Journal of Urology, IEEE Transactions on Biomedical Engineering and European Urology.
